Police have released the shocking footage that shows a drink driver in County Durham narrowly miss a pedestrian before ploughing into the front of a shop. 

In the video, which Durham Police are using as a warning to drivers across the region this festive period, the police force has compiled several incidents that show the actions of drink drivers. 

The clip, which was taken earlier this year, sees a row of people in the street outside pubs before a car can be seen speeding from a nearby junction.

The car then revs towards a pedestrian, nearly running them down, before hitting the front of a shop. 

In other clips, footage of cars on their roofs, cars crashing into bollards and parked cars can be seen.
